WebJan 15, 2024 · Firstly, you need to group your main steps of a flow into a Scope control. There are various advantages of a scope. It makes your flow appear more compact, can make it easier to navigate and understand, and most importantly means you can use the result() expression to obtain the history of an action. In my example below my main steps … WebFeb 17, 2024 · To catch exceptions in a Failed scope and run actions that handle those errors, you can use the "run after" setting that Failed scope. That way, if any actions in the scope fail, and you use the "run after" setting for that scope, you can create a single action to catch failures.
